Dr Stephen Ahenkorah holds PhD in Biomedical Sciences (Radiopharmacy) and currently works as an associate research scientist at the radiology department of the University of Iowa. Prior to this position he was a postdoctoral fellow at KU Leuven, Belgium where he developed an agent called 3p-C-NETA-TATE for targeting neuroendocrine tumors in vivo.
